Business Roof Inspection Services

Business ro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of commercial roofing systems to identify potential issues that could compromise the integrity of the roof. These inspections typically include visual examinations of the roof’s surface, drainage systems, flashing, and other critical components. Some providers may also utilize specialized tools or technology, such as drones or moisture meters, to detect hidden problems like leaks, material deterioration, or structural weaknesses that are not immediately visible. Regular inspections help ensure that commercial properties maintain their roofing systems in good condition and can prevent small issues from escalating into costly repairs or replacements.

One of the primary benefits of professional roof inspections is the early detection of problems that may lead to leaks, water damage, or structural deterioration. By identifying issues such as damaged flashing, cracks, ponding water, or membrane breaches early, property owners and managers can address them before they develop into more extensive and expensive repairs. Additionally, inspections can help verify the condition of the roof for insurance or maintenance planning purposes. Regular assessments also support compliance with warranties and property management standards, contributing to the overall longevity and performance of the roofing system.

Commercial properties that commonly utilize roof inspection services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, industrial facilities, and multi-family residential complexes. These properties often have large, flat roofs or complex roofing systems that require routine monitoring to ensure safety and functionality. Property managers and business owners rely on professional inspections to maintain the value of their investments, prevent operational disruptions caused by roof failures, and extend the lifespan of their roofing assets. Scheduled inspections are especially important for properties in areas prone to severe weather, where damage from storms or heavy snowfall can be a concern.

What is included in a business roof inspection? A professional roof inspection assesses the overall condition of the roof, identifies potential issues such as leaks, damage, or wear, and evaluates the integrity of roofing materials and drainage systems.

How often should a business ro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spection at least once a year and after severe weather events to ensure ongoing safety and performance.

What are common signs that a roof needs repair? Visible signs include water stains on ceilings, missing or damaged shingles, sagging areas, and increased granule loss in roofing materials.

Can a roof inspection help prevent costly repairs? Yes, regular inspections can identify issues early, allowing for timely repairs that may prevent more extensive and expensive damage later.

How do local pros perform a roof inspection? Local professionals typically examine the roof surface, check for damage or deterioration, assess flashing and seals, and evaluate drainage systems to provide a comprehensive report.
